Interface LineBackgroundListener

All Superinterfaces:
EventListener, SWTEventListener
All Known Implementing Classes:
CursorLinePainter, TextConsoleViewer
Functional Interface:
This is a functional interface and can therefore be used as the assignment target for a lambda expression or method reference.

@FunctionalInterface public interface LineBackgroundListener extends SWTEventListener
Classes which implement this interface provide a method that can provide the background color for a line that is to be drawn.
See Also:
  • Method Summary

    Modifier and Type
    Method
    Description
    void
    This method is called when a line is about to be drawn in order to get its background color.
  • Method Details

    • lineGetBackground

      void lineGetBackground(LineBackgroundEvent event)
      This method is called when a line is about to be drawn in order to get its background color.

      The following event fields are used:

      • event.lineOffset line start offset (input)
      • event.lineText line text (input)
      • event.lineBackground line background color (output)
      Parameters:
      event - the given event
      See Also: